For months now users have been begging for a truly great title to be brought to the PlayStation Network from the original PlayStation. Even though we’ve been supplied with Crash Bandicoot and Jet Moto, it never seemed to be enough to hold us over. We were always asking for the bigger and better title. Well, we think Sony may have heard us all.
Instead of lining up just one solid title, Sony has seemingly given the Official PlayStation Magazine there of them. According to their latest issue, Grand Theft Auto, Grand Theft Auto II, and Street Fighter Alpha should all be making their appearance for download on the PSN. These two franchises have been key cornerstones for the PlayStation brand and it only makes sense that they would eventually find themselves on the downloadable side of things.
As most of us know the original over-the-top GTA games were what gave Rockstar their huge success. For the younger crowd who haven’t yet had the chance to experience these titles, you’re in for a surprise. They’re nothing like San Andreas or Vice City, they’re unique to themselves and beyond respectable. So for everyone out there waiting for GTA IV, maybe we can spend that time playing the founding father of the franchise before release.
Official release dates haven’t been given, but we’ll keep you posted on when they are.
